Alibaba’s AI Ambitions Fuel Market Optimism

Felix Baarz by Felix Baarz
October 14, 2025
in AI & Quantum Computing, Analysis, Asian Markets, E-Commerce, Tech & Software
0
Alibaba Stock
0
SHARES
33
VIEWS
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

In a surprising market development on Monday, Chinese technology behemoth Alibaba demonstrated remarkable resilience amid ongoing trade tensions between the United States and China. While other Chinese technology stocks faced downward pressure, Alibaba shares surged significantly. This unexpected performance stems from a fundamental reassessment by Wall Street analysts, who are now recognizing the company’s substantial potential beyond its traditional e-commerce roots. The central question emerging is whether Alibaba can successfully transform from an online retail giant into a dominant force in artificial intelligence.

Strategic Shift in Analyst Perspective

The investment landscape for Alibaba underwent a substantial recalibration following Goldman Sachs’ revised assessment. The prominent investment bank has shifted its analytical focus from Alibaba’s conventional online retail operations to emphasize its expanding cloud computing and artificial intelligence divisions. Their financial projections reveal compelling growth trajectories, with external cloud revenues forecast to expand by 33%, 29%, and 19% over the next three fiscal years respectively.

Equally noteworthy are the anticipated capital expenditures. Goldman Sachs analysts project investments totaling 460 billion Chinese yuan between fiscal years 2026 and 2028. These substantial resources will be strategically allocated toward developing multimodal AI technologies and establishing a more diversified semiconductor supply chain—a clear strategic maneuver to reduce dependency on individual chip suppliers.

Broad-Based Institutional Confidence

Morgan Stanley reinforced this optimistic outlook by maintaining its “Overweight” rating on Alibaba stock. Their research team has identified the company as “China’s premier AI enabler” and anticipates cloud revenue will surge 32% year-over-year during the second quarter of fiscal 2026.

This positive sentiment extends across multiple financial institutions. Both Daiwa Securities and China International Capital Corporation (CICC) have echoed similar confidence, pointing to emerging signs of profit stabilization within Alibaba’s e-commerce platforms Taobao and Tmall. Additionally, they highlight the substantial long-term potential embedded in the company’s comprehensive full-stack AI service offerings.

Navigating Geopolitical Headwinds

The timing of this corporate reevaluation is particularly significant. As trade disputes between Washington and Beijing intensify and create pressure on numerous Chinese technology equities, Alibaba has managed to defy the prevailing negative trend. Market experts at Goldman Sachs contend that investors must look beyond Alibaba’s e-commerce heritage and acknowledge the substantial future value represented by its cloud and AI initiatives.

Although substantial investments in areas such as flash-purchase services may temporarily impact profitability, industry observers view these expenditures as strategically essential. The company’s established e-commerce operations combined with its rapidly expanding cloud business create a solid foundation from which to launch its ambitious artificial intelligence offensive.
